Transaction 2941664d126ec3940e1b817b35b850cacd530724ac5af13a5831e4309306587b
1 Input
1 Output
-
2941664d126ec3940e1b817b35b850cacd530724ac5af13a5831e4309306587b:0
- value
- 175638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e16b96e490905791c63b02814e28e96d8c65f86 OP_EQUAL
- address
- 3QrWnBbLrGiWmGixqwf1SKgSbsiz9mZS6Z